    What Venus does, and where the 3rd house puts it

    In a birth chart Venus describes attraction and relating: what you find beautiful, what you value, and the ways you seek common ground, harmony and fairness. It is the part of you that would rather find the shared note in a room than win the argument in it, the taste that hears a sentence and knows where it wants to land.

    The third house is the territory of the local and the spoken: your neighborhood, siblings, short journeys, early schooling, language, and the everyday traffic of messages and talk. It is the corner shop and the group chat, the street you know by heart, the words that carry an ordinary Tuesday.

    In natal interpretation the planet identifies the function and the house identifies the field of life in which it operates. Venus says what delights; the third house says where: in the saying. Affection, for you, arrives as conversation. Beauty lives in words, and a good talk at a kitchen table can do for you what a holiday does for other people. The rest of it is delivery.

    The other end of the axis

    The third house does not stand alone. It sits on an axis with the ninth, and that axis relates local learning, language, everyday movement and the immediate context to wider meaning, higher study, belief and journeys beyond the familiar frame. One end is the street you know by heart. The other end is the horizon that keeps asking whether the street is all there is.

    Read as a pair it explains a restlessness in your talking. The daily conversation wants charm; the far end wants meaning, and a life of purely local pleasantness starts, after a while, to itch. The best evenings are the ones where the kitchen-table talk accidentally turns cosmological at eleven, and the neighborhood chatter opens onto a question none of you can close. Your language wants both distances, and it has not finished stretching.

    Neither end is the real one. They are two ends of one line, and the line is what you actually live in. The heavens have been a conversation piece longer than anyone remembers.

    What this page cannot tell you

    It cannot tell you whether this is yours, because houses are built from a moment, not a date. The Ascendant is the sign that was rising over the eastern horizon at the exact moment and place you were born, and it changes sign roughly every one to two hours. In whole-sign houses the sign holding the Ascendant becomes the first house, each following sign becomes the next, and your third is two signs on from your first. Change the hour or the town, and the whole wheel turns.

    Two people born on the same day in different towns write from different third houses. The sky gave them different horizons, with different streets beneath them. A birthday alone gives your Sun. It cannot give you this, and any page that suggests otherwise is promising a recognition it cannot deliver.

    Do I need my birth time to know which house my Venus is in?

    Yes, and your birthplace with it. The Ascendant is the sign rising over the eastern horizon at the exact moment and place of birth, and it changes sign roughly every one to two hours. In whole-sign houses the sign that contains it becomes the first house and each following sign becomes the next. Without the hour and the town there is no Ascendant, and without an Ascendant there are no houses. The houses begin where the sky met your first morning.
